背景技术Background technique

农业灌溉,主要是指对农业耕作区进行的灌溉作业。农业灌溉方式一般可分为传统的地面灌溉、普通喷灌以及微灌。现有技术中,主要通过水泵将水箱中的水输送到灌溉管道进行灌溉。考虑到水资源的重要性,在干旱地区,人们通常将雨水收集起来,用以灌溉,通过对雨水的收集,可节约水资源的消耗。Agricultural irrigation mainly refers to the irrigation of agricultural farming areas. Agricultural irrigation methods can generally be divided into traditional surface irrigation, ordinary sprinkler irrigation and micro-irrigation. In the prior art, the water in the water tank is mainly delivered to the irrigation pipeline by the water pump for irrigation. Considering the importance of water resources, in arid areas, people usually collect rainwater for irrigation. By collecting rainwater, the consumption of water resources can be saved.

现有技术中,通常会采用接水器具来对雨水进行承接,如接水漏斗,进入到漏斗中的水通过管道流入到蓄水箱中进行存储。为避免外界的杂物进入到漏斗中而导致管道堵塞,通常会采用滤网对雨水进行过滤,然而滤网易被杂物堵塞而无法过滤,滤网不具备自动化清理的功能,需要人工手动进行拆装、清理,较为不便。In the prior art, a water receiving device is usually used to receive rainwater, such as a water receiving funnel, and the water entering the funnel flows into a water storage tank through a pipe for storage. In order to prevent external debris from entering the funnel and causing pipeline blockage, a filter is usually used to filter rainwater. However, the filter is easily blocked by debris and cannot be filtered. The filter does not have the function of automatic cleaning and needs to be manually dismantled. It is inconvenient to install and clean up.

该一种具有节水控水功能的农业灌溉器的工作原理:在进行灌溉时,通过启动水泵6,可将蓄水箱1内部的水输送到喷管7中,在喷管7上设置相应的灌溉喷头,可对植物进行灌溉。外界雨水可通过接水漏斗4进行收集,雨水通过接水漏斗4进入到盒体3中后,可被盒体3内部的滤网12进行过滤。过滤后的污水可向下流动到挡板9上。随着挡板9上雨水的增多,雨水对挡板9的压力可使挡板9向下转动,第一弹簧11进行压缩,进而挡板9与固定板10相互分离,雨水可通过挡板9与盒体3内壁之间的间隔向下流动。随后雨水可通过管道2流入到蓄水箱1中存储。当停止下雨水,挡板9上残留的雨水慢慢地不能够产生对挡板9足够的压力来使挡板9向下转动,在第一弹簧11的弹力作用下,可使挡板9再次与固定板10相抵,来对盒体3的流通路径进行封堵,防止蓄水箱1内存储的水资源通过管道2快速挥发。The working principle of this agricultural irrigator with water-saving and water-controlling functions: when irrigating, by starting the water pump 6, the water inside the water storage tank 1 can be delivered to the nozzle pipe 7, and the nozzle pipe 7 is provided with a corresponding Irrigation nozzles for irrigating plants. External rainwater can be collected through the water receiving funnel 4, and after the rainwater enters the box body 3 through the water receiving funnel 4, it can be filtered by the filter screen 12 inside the box body 3. The filtered sewage can flow down to the baffle plate 9 . Along with the increase of rainwater on the baffle plate 9, the pressure of the rainwater on the baffle plate 9 can make the baffle plate 9 rotate downwards, the first spring 11 is compressed, and then the baffle plate 9 and the fixed plate 10 are separated from each other, and the rainwater can pass through the baffle plate 9 The gap with the inner wall of the box body 3 flows downward. The rainwater can then flow into the storage tank 1 through the pipeline 2 for storage. When it stops raining, the remaining rainwater on the baffle plate 9 cannot produce enough pressure on the baffle plate 9 slowly to make the baffle plate 9 rotate downwards, and under the elastic force of the first spring 11, the baffle plate 9 can be turned again. Offset against the fixed plate 10 to block the circulation path of the box body 3 and prevent the water resources stored in the water storage tank 1 from quickly volatilizing through the pipeline 2 .

另外,通过控制电动推杆15启动,电动推杆15伸长时,可带动套设在滑杆13上的刮板14在滑杆13上滑动,刮板14的底端可对滤网12的上表面进行刮动,可将过滤在滤网12上的杂物刮向排渣口17。随着刮板14靠近排渣口17,刮板14上的固定杆16会先抵住盖板18,使盖板18向外翻转,进一步地将盖板18抵开。当刮板14继续向排渣口17推动时,可将从滤网12上刮除的杂物通过排渣口17推出到盒体3外,以此实现对滤网12的自动清洁功能。清洁完成后,控制电动推杆15收缩,刮板14进行复位。盖板18失去了固定杆16的推挤作用力,在第二弹簧19的弹力下,可使盖板18重新盖合在排渣口17上。In addition, by controlling the electric push rod 15 to start, when the electric push rod 15 is extended, it can drive the scraper 14 sleeved on the slide bar 13 to slide on the slide bar 13, and the bottom end of the scraper 14 can touch the bottom of the filter screen 12. The upper surface is scraped to scrape the sundries filtered on the filter screen 12 to the slag outlet 17 . As the scraper 14 approaches the slag discharge port 17, the fixed rod 16 on the scraper 14 will first press against the cover plate 18, causing the cover plate 18 to turn outward, and further push the cover plate 18 away. When the scraper 14 continues to push toward the slag discharge port 17, the debris scraped off from the filter screen 12 can be pushed out of the box body 3 through the slag discharge port 17, thereby realizing the automatic cleaning function of the filter screen 12. After the cleaning is completed, the electric push rod 15 is controlled to shrink, and the scraper 14 is reset. The cover plate 18 has lost the pushing force of the fixed rod 16, and under the elastic force of the second spring 19, the cover plate 18 can be covered on the slag discharge port 17 again.
